BARE BONES HTML-OPAS

Kevin Werbach
<barebones@werbach.com>
Pikakäännös Mika Hämäläinen
<mika.hamalainen@interweb.fi>
Versio 2.0 Taulukoilla -- Joulukuu 27, 1995
(Tämä sivu vaatii taulukota tukevan selaimen)


Tämä muistilistanomainen yhteenveto yleisimmistä HTML-komennoista on alkujaan Kevin Werbachin käsialaa. Uusimmat versiot ja erikielistet käännökset listasta lyötyvät osoitteesta < http://werbach.com/barebones/>.

Tässä oppaassa on vain hyvin lyhyet selvitykset komennoista. Komentoja laajemmin esitteleviä oppaita on runsaasti saatavilla esimerkiksi Werbachin kotisivulta <http://werbach.com/web/wwwhelp.html#guides>. Useimmat näistä ovat kuitenkin englanniksi. Jukka Packalenin pieni suomenkielinen opas lyötyy osoitteesta <http://www.helsinki.fi/~jpackale/html-opas.html>.

Tässä oppaassa on listattu lähes kaikki käytössä olevat "viralliset" HTML 2.0 komennot. Lisäksi on esitelty Netscapen laajennukset sekä useita HTML 3.0 komentojoukkoon mahdollisesti tulevia komentoja.

Tämä versio oppaasta on PIKAKÄÄNNÖS, ja saattaa sisältää runsaasti kirjoitus- ja ajatusvirheitä. Jouduin myös luomaan hieman uudissanoja, josta osa on varsin omituisia... (Sample Output=Uloste, Frame=Kehys...) Mikäli löydät virheitä, tai haluat ehdottaa parempia uudissanoja, pistäppä postia Mika Hämäläiselle <mika.hamalainen@interweb.fi>.

Kommentteja ja ehdoituksia voi lähettää suoraan Kevin Werbachille <barebones@werbach.com> tai Mika Hämäläiselle <mika.hamalainen@interweb.fi>.

Kevin haluaa kiittä myös seuraavia henkilöitä:


Oppaassa käytetyt symbolit

URL    Universal Resource Locator, "Maailmankaikkeuden resurssien paikallistaja" :-)
       Viittaus toiseen tiedostoon
?      Jokin numero (esim. <H?> tarkoittaa <H1> - <H6>)
%      Jokin prosentti (esim. <HR WIDTH=%> voisi olla <HR WIDTH=50%>...)
***    Jokin teksti (esim. ALT="***" johon jokin kuvausteksti)    
$$$$$$ Jokin heksa (esim. BGCOLOR="#$$$$$$" voisi olla BGCOLOR="#00FF1C")
,,,    Pilkkujen määrä (esim. COORDS=",,," tarkoittaa COORDS="0,0,50,50")
|      Vaihtoehdot (esim. ALIGN=LEFT|RIGHT|CENTER, jokin näistä)

Yhteensopivuus

(Muista että HTML ja selaimet kehittyvät koko ajan)
(ei merkkiä) HTML 2.0; toimii "kaikissa" selaimissa N1.0 Netscape laajennus, esiteltiin Navigator 1.0 versiossa N1.1 Netscape laajennus, esiteltiin Navigator 1.1 versiossa N2.0 Netscape laajennus, esiteltiin Navigator 2.0 versiossa 3.0 HTML 3.0 komento; toimii yleisimmissä uusissa selaimissa + Tämä Netscape laajennus toimii yleisimmissä selaimissa

Kommentteja ja ehdoituksia voi lähettää suoraan Kevin Werbachille <barebones@werbach.com> tai Mika Hämäläiselle <mika.hamalainen@interweb.fi>.

Sisällys


YLEISET (Nämä tulisi löytyä kaikista HTML-dokumenteista)
Dokumenttityyppi "prologue"<HTML></HTML>(dokumentin alussa ja lopussa)
Ikkunan nimi "titteli"<TITLE></TITLE>(pitää sijaita tunnisteessa)
Tunniste "head"<HEAD></HEAD>(dokumenttia kuvaavaa informaatiota)
Runko "body"<BODY></BODY>(runkon sisältämät asia näkyvät sivulla)
 

LOOGISET MUOTOILUKOMENNOT (Selain määrittää tyylin ulkoasun)
Otsikko<H?></H?>(otsikkotasoja on kuusi)
3.0Otsikon sijoittelu<H? ALIGN=LEFT|CENTER|RIGHT></H?>
3.0Jako<DIV></DIV>
3.0Jaon sijoittelu<DIV ALIGN=LEFT|RIGHT|CENTER|JUSTIFY></DIV>
Sitaattikappale<BLOCKQUOTE></BLOCKQUOTE>(Yleensä kapeampi, sisennetty palsta)
Painotus<EM></EM>(yleensä kursiivi)
Vahva painotus<STRONG></STRONG>(yleensä lihavoitu)
Sitaatti<CITE></CITE>(yleensä kursiivi)
Koodi<CODE></CODE>(lähdekoodin listaus)
Uloste :-)<SAMP></SAMP>
Syöte<KBD></KBD>
Muuttuja<VAR></VAR>
Määritelmä<DFN></DFN>(ei yleisessä käytössä)
Tekijän osoite<ADDRESS></ADDRESS>
3.0Iso kirjasinkoko<BIG></BIG>
3.0Pieni kirjasinkoko<SMALL></SMALL>
 

PAKOTTAVAT MUOTOILUKOMENNOT (Tekijä määrittää tyylin ulkonäön)
Lihavointi<B></B>
Kursiivi<I></I>
3.0Alleviivaus<U></U>(ei vielä yleisessä käytössä)
3.0Ylilyönti<S></S>(ei vielä yleisessä käytössä)
3.0?? Alaindeksi<SUB></SUB>
3.0?? Yläindeksi<SUP></SUP>
Kirjoituskone<TT></TT>(käyttää "fixed font" -kirjasinta)
Esimuotoiltu<PRE></PRE> (käyttää "fixed font" -kirjasinta, ja esimuotoiltuja välejä)
Leveys<PRE WIDTH=?></PRE>(merkeissä)
N1.0+Keskitys<CENTER></CENTER>(tekstille, kuville ja taulukoille)
N1.0Välkkyminen<BLINK></BLINK>(eniten pahennusta aiheuttanut komento)
N1.0Kirjasinkoko<FONT SIZE=?></FONT>(välillä 1-7)
N1.0Kirjasinkoon muutos<FONT SIZE=+|-?></FONT>
N1.0Oletus kirjasinkoko<BASEFONT SIZE=?>(välillä 1-7; oletusarvo 3)
N2.0Kirjasimen väri<FONT COLOR="#$$$$$$"></FONT>
 

LINKIT JA KUVAT
Linkki<A HREF="URL"></A>
Linkki kohteeseen<A HREF="URL#***"></A>(jos toisessa dokumentissa)
<A HREF="#***"></A>(if in current document)
N2.0Kohdeikkuna<A HREF="URL" TARGET="***"></A>
Nimeä kohde<A NAME="***"></A>
Näytä kuva<IMG SRC="URL">
Sijoittelu<IMG SRC="URL" ALIGN=TOP|BOTTOM|MIDDLE>
N1.0Sijoittelu<IMG SRC="URL" ALIGN=LEFT|RIGHT|TEXTTOP|
ABSMIDDLE|BASELINE|ABSBOTTOM>
Kuvan korvaava teksti<IMG SRC="URL" ALT="***">(jos kuvaa ei näytetä)
Sensitiivinen kuva<IMG SRC="URL" ISMAP>(vaatii skriptin)
N2.0Sensitiivinen kuva<IMG SRC="URL" USEMAP="URL">
N2.0Kartta<MAP NAME="***"></MAP>(kuvaa kartan)
N2.0Alue<AREA SHAPE="RECT" COORDS=",,," HREF="URL"|NOHREF>
3.0Koon määritys<IMG SRC="URL" WIDTH="?" HEIGHT="?">(pikseleinä)
N1.0Reunus<IMG SRC="URL" BORDER=?>(pikseleinä)
N1.0Marginaali<IMG SRC="URL" HSPACE=? VSPACE=?>(pikseleinä)
N1.0Matalaresoluutioinen esikuva<IMG SRC="URL" LOWSRC="URL">
N1.1Selain veto<META HTTP-EQUIV="Refresh" CONTENT="?; URL=URL">
N2.0Liitä objekti<EMBED SRC="URL">(liittää objektin sivulle)
N2.0Objektin koko<EMBED SRC="URL" WIDTH="?" HEIGHT="?">
 

JAKAJAT
Kappale<P>(yleensä kaksi rivinvaihtoa)
3.0Kappale<P></P>
3.0Tekstin sijoittelu<P ALIGN=LEFT|CENTER|RIGHT></P>
Rivin lopetus<BR>(rivinvaihto)
N1.0Lopeta tekstinkierrätys<BR CLEAR=LEFT|RIGHT|ALL>
Vaakaviiva<HR>
N1.0Sijoittelu<HR ALIGN=LEFT|RIGHT|CENTER>
N1.0Paksuus<HR SIZE=?>(pikseleinä)
N1.0Leveys<HR WIDTH=?>(pikseleinä)
N1.0Leveys prosentteina<HR WIDTH=%>(prosenttia sivun leveydestä)
N1.0Varjostamaton viiva<HR NOSHADE>(yksivärinen, ei 3D-efektiä)
N1.0Ei rivinvaihtoa<NOBR></NOBR>(estää rivinvaihdon)
N1.0Sanaväli<WBR>(kun rivinvaitoa tarvitaan)
 

LISTAT (Listoja voidaan asettaa sisäkkäin)
Järjestämätön lista<UL><LI></UL>(<LI> ennen jokaista listan elementtiä)
N1.0Merkin tyyppi<UL TYPE=DISC|CIRCLE|SQUARE>(koko listalle)
<LI TYPE=DISC|CIRCLE|SQUARE>(tälle ja seuraaville)
Järjestyslista<OL><LI></OL>(<LI> ennen jokaista listan elementtiä)
N1.0Järjestysmerkin tyyppi<OL TYPE=A|a|I|i|1>(koko listalle)
<LI TYPE=A|a|I|i|1>(tälle ja seuraaville)
N1.0Aloitusmerkki<OL VALUE=?>(koko listalle)
<LI VALUE=?>(tälle ja seuraaville)
Määrittelylista<DL><DT><DD></DL>(<DT>=term, <DD>=definition)
Valikkolista<MENU><LI></MENU>(<LI> ennen jokaista listan elementtiä)
Hakemistolista<DIR><LI></DIR>(<LI> ennen jokaista listan elementtiä)
 

VÄRIT JA TAUSTAT
3.0Taustakuva<BODY BACKGROUND="URL">
N1.1+Taustaväri<BODY BGCOLOR="#$$$$$$">

(järjestys on punainen/vihreä/sininen, red/green/blue)
N1.1+Tekstiväri<BODY TEXT="#$$$$$$">
N1.1+Linkkiväri<BODY LINK="#$$$$$$">
N1.1+Käytetyn linkin väri<BODY VLINK="#$$$$$$">
N1.1Aktiivisen linkin väri<BODY ALINK="#$$$$$$">
 

ERIKOISMERKIT (Nämä tulee kirjoittaa pienillä kirjaimilla)
Erikoismerkki&#?;
<&lt;
>&gt;
&&amp;
"&quot;
ä&auml;
Ä&Auml;
ö&ouml;
Ö&Ouml;
å&aring;
Å&Aring;
Rekisteröity tuotemerkki&#174;
N1.0+Rekisteröity tuotemerkki&reg;
Copyright&#169;
N1.0+Copyright&copy;
 

LOMAKKEET (Kenttien vietit välitetään palvelijassa sijaitsevalle ohjelmalle)
Määritä lomake<FORM ACTION="URL" METHOD=GET|POST></FORM>
N2.0Liitä tiedosto<FORM ENCTYPE="multipart/form-data></FORM>
Syöttökenttä<INPUT TYPE="TEXT|PASSWORD|CHECKBOX|
RADIO|IMAGE|HIDDEN|SUBMIT|RESET">
Kentän nimi<INPUT NAME="***">
Kentän oletusarvo<INPUT VALUE="***">
Esivalittu<INPUT CHECKED>(checkbox ja radio)
Kentän koko<INPUT SIZE=?>(merkkeinä)
Maximi pituus<INPUT MAXLENGTH=?>(merkkeinä)
Valintalista<SELECT></SELECT>
Listan nimi<SELECT NAME="***"></SELECT>
Vaihtoehtojen lukumäärä<SELECT SIZE=?></SELECT>
Monivalinta<SELECT MULTIPLE>(voi valita useampia)
Vaihtoehto<OPTION>(valinta vaihtoehdot)
Oletusvaihtoehto<OPTION SELECTED>
Tekstikentän koko<TEXTAREA ROWS=? COLS=?></TEXTAREA>
Tekstikentän nimi<TEXTAREA NAME="***"></TEXTAREA>
N2.0Tekstin kierrätys<TEXTAREA WRAP=OFF|VIRTUAL|PHYSICAL></TEXTAREA>
 

TAULUKOT
3.0Määrittele taulukko<TABLE></TABLE>
3.0Taulukon reunus<TABLE BORDER></TABLE>(joko tai)
N1.1Taulukon reunus<TABLE BORDER=?></TABLE>(voi antaa arvon)
N1.1Soluväli<TABLE CELLSPACING=?>
N1.1Solujen marginaali<TABLE CELLPADDING=?>
N1.1Tavoite leveys<TABLE WIDTH=?>(in pixels)
N1.1Leveys prosentteina<TABLE WIDTH=%>(prosenttia sivunleveydestä)
3.0Taulukkorivi<TR></TR>
3.0Sijoittelu<TR ALIGN=LEFT|RIGHT|CENTER
VALIGN=TOP|MIDDLE|BOTTOM>
3.0Taulukkosolu<TD></TD>(täytyy sijaita taulukkorivin sisässä)
3.0Sijoittelu<TD ALIGN=LEFT|RIGHT|CENTER
VALIGN=TOP|MIDDLE|BOTTOM>
3.0Ei rivinvaihtoja<TD NOWRAP>
3.0Leveys kolumneina<TD COLSPAN=?>
3.0Korkeus riveinä<TD ROWSPAN=?>
N1.1Tavoiteleveys<TD WIDTH=?>(pikseleinä)
N1.1Leveys prosentteina<TD WIDTH=%>(prosenttia taulukon leveydestä)
3.0Taulukko-otsikko<TH></TH>(sama kuin data, mutta lihavoituna ja keskitettynä)
3.0Sijoittelu<TH ALIGN=LEFT|RIGHT|CENTER
VALIGN=TOP|MIDDLE|BOTTOM>
3.0Ei rivinvaihtoja<TH NOWRAP>
3.0Leveys kolumneina<TH COLSPAN=?>
3.0Korkeus riveinä<TH ROWSPAN=?>
N1.1Tavoiteleveys<TH WIDTH=?>(pikseleinä)
N1.1Leveys prosentteina<TH WIDTH=%>(prosenttia taulukon leveydestä)
3.0Taulukon oheisteksti<CAPTION></CAPTION>
3.0Sijoittelu<CAPTION ALIGN=TOP|BOTTOM>(taulukon alla/pällä)
 

KEHYKSET
N2.0Kehys Dokumentti<FRAMESET></FRAMESET>(<BODY>-komennon sijasta)
N2.0Kehyksen korkeus riveinä<FRAMESET ROWS=,,,></FRAMESET>()
N2.0Kehyksen korkeus riveinä<FRAMESET ROWS=*></FRAMESET>(* = suhteellinen koko)
N2.0Kehyksen leveys kolumneina<FRAMESET COLS=,,,></FRAMESET>(pikseliä tai %)
N2.0Kehyksen leveys kolumneina<FRAMESET COLS=*></FRAMESET>(* = suhteellinen koko)
N2.0Määritä kehys<FRAME>(yksittäinen kehys)
N2.0Näytä dokumentti<FRAME SRC="URL">
N2.0Kehyksen nimi<FRAME NAME="***"|_blank|_self|_parent|_top>
N2.0Marginaalin leveys<FRAME MARGINWIDTH=?>(vasen ja oikea marginaali)
N2.0Marginaalin korkeus<FRAME MARGINHEIGHT=?>(ylä ja alamarginaali)
N2.0kehyksen vieritettävyys<FRAME SCROLLING="YES|NO|AUTO">
N2.0Sidottu koko<FRAME NORESIZE>
N2.0Sisältö kehyksettömille selaimille<NOFRAMES></NOFRAMES>(selaimille jotka eivät tue kehys-komentoa)
SEKALAISET
Kommentti<!-- *** -->(ei näy sivulla)
Dokumentin tyyppi<!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ML 2.0//EN">
3.0Dokumentin tyyppi<!DOCTYPE HTML PUBLIC "-//W3O//DTD W3 HTML 3.0//EN">
Haettava dokumentti<ISINDEX>
N1.0?? Prompt<ISINDEX PROMPT="***">(syöttöä osoittava teksti)
Lähetä haku<A HREF="URL?***"></a>(käytä oikeata kysymysmerkkiä)
Dokumentin osoite<BASE HREF="URL">(täytyy sijaita tunniste-osiossa)
N2.0Oletusikkunan nimi<BASE TARGET="***">(täytyy sijaita tunniste-osiossa)
relaatio<LINK REV="***" REL="***" HREF="URL">(täytyy sijaita tunniste-osiossa)
Metainformaatio<META>(täytyy sijaita tunniste-osiossa)
 

Copyright © 1995, 1996 Kevin Werbach. Noncommercial redistribution permitted. This Guide is not a product of Bare Bones Software, although it is distributed with some versions of the BBEdit text editor; the similarity of names is purely coincidental.


Kevin's Home Page